FENS travel grants available to attend the 17th Annual Meeting of the Chinese Neuroscience Society in 2024 (CNS 2024)

FENS travel grants are available to support postdoctoral fellows and PhD students to attend the 17th Annual Meeting of the Chinese Neuroscience Society (CNS 2024), which will take place from 26-29 September 2024, in Suzhou, China.

These grants – of up to EUR 1.300 each – are intended to cover the associated travel expenses of the awardees. The registration fee for the FENS travel grants awardees to the CNS 2024 is waived.

The candidates – postdocs within maximum 3 years after obtaining their PhD or PhD students – should be part of a FENS member society.  The grant recipients will have their registration fees waived and will be invited to join the Youth Forum Session. It is mandatory for grant recipients to make oral presentations and facilitate interaction, typically held on the afternoon of the first day of the CNS annual meeting.

Applications must include:

  • Short CV (two page maximum)
  • Abstract as presenting-first author (up to 400 words)
  • One short letter of recommendation

Candidates should not be the recipients of:

  • a FENS travel grant to attend the Japan Neuroscience meeting in 2024
  • other grants related to the 17th Annual Meeting of the Chinese Neuroscience Society. Upon selection by FENS, the awardees must submit the abstract and meet the JNS deadline of Late-Breaking Abstracts (to be determined)

Application closed on 3 March 2024
